Indigrid
Indigrid

Description: Indigrid is an open-source platform for decentralized energy trading and coordination. It enables local energy producers to sell excess energy to consumers in their community through a transparent peer-to-peer marketplace.

Indigrid
Indigrid
Pros
  • Promotes renewable energy use
  • Lower energy costs through disintermediation
  • Increased grid resilience and optimization
Cons
  • Requires widespread adoption to realize full benefits
  • Complex regulatory environment in some areas
  • Significant upfront infrastructure investment
